Output 59b8da6a748d34cd20f77ceeaac2f0445222807191fb8f0220b8ba9303ceda72:19

value
153385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a73dcb5efc09023af8b50aa06b5f9a443df0832 OP_EQUALVERIFY OP_CHECKSIG
address
19FGcWULzMXFjcRfZHsiKuaP1NZ5X49Q6o
transaction
59b8da6a748d34cd20f77ceeaac2f0445222807191fb8f0220b8ba9303ceda72
spent
true